So, "Apocryphal County" dives deep into the world Faulkner created, and it’s not what you might expect from a typical documentary. The pacing has this hypnotic quality, guiding you through the landscapes and stories that shaped his fiction. Lachassagne’s approach is both cerebral and visceral, weaving in soundscapes that make you feel the weight of the South’s history. The visuals are striking, almost ethereal at times, and they really capture the essence of Faulkner’s imagination. There’s a sense of exploration, you know, peeling back layers of authenticity and myth. The performances in the narrative reenactments add a unique flavor, blending reality with Faulkner’s literary world in a way that feels both fresh and familiar. If you’re into literature-driven cinema, this one’s got layers to unpack.
